The City Harvest Church Criminal Breach of Trust (CBT) Case is the biggest Criminal Breach of Trust (CBT) case in Singapore since the beginning of the 21st century. Church founder Kong Hee was found guilty of misappropriating some S$50 million of church funds with the help of five key church leaders. … See more Church member blows the whistle In January 2003, a businessman who had been attending the church for six years contacted and wrote in to the Straits Times, alleging that church members were being encouraged to buy See more In June 2012, Kong Hee and four other members of the church were arrested by the Commercial Affairs Department of the Singapore Police Force.
